Gene expression of hepatic glucocorticoid receptor NR3C1 and correlation with plasmatic corticosterone in Italian chickens.

Articolo
Data di Pubblicazione:
2010
Abstract:
This study examined breed-specific stress related hormonal and gene expression profiles in 10
three Italian chicken breeds (Valdarnese Bianca, Bionda Piemontese, Robusta Maculata)
reared in controlled conditions. Glucocorticoids work through the glucocorticoid receptor
(GR), which modulates target genes transcription. We investigated breed-specific changes
in corticosterone (ELISA) and GR expression. GR mRNA levels were analyzed using
one-tube, two-temperature real-time PCR for absolute quantification of the gene expression 15
by the standard curve method. Our results show high expression of GR in hepatic tissue. Significant
effect of the breed was recorded for plasma corticosterone concentration: Valdarnese
Bianca 3.35 ng/ml, Bionda Piemontese 1.73 ng/ml, Robusta Maculata 2.02 ng/ml. Breed
specific gene expression has been recorded with a GR ranging from 1.12Eþ04 (Robusta
Maculata) to 1.00Eþ05 (Bionda Piemontese) mRNA copy number/100 ng total RNA. 20
Negative correlation was found between gene expression and blood corticosterone level.
